Output 7d39124e55725f592c8e82c59b29851958bff6851c709ac13b8299a19dc52f49:0

value
4596000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ef77b683bd206183e55f4d4374955fb092437688 OP_EQUAL
address
3PXCqC8Kro283aWSrPWhbmsW7SY8qzewwp
transaction
7d39124e55725f592c8e82c59b29851958bff6851c709ac13b8299a19dc52f49
confirmations
410869
spent
true